    Read the following statements carefully and choose the correct option. (i) Saurabh had Rs 50. He bought chocolates for Rs 45.25. Then the amount of money left with Saurabh is Rs 4.75. (ii) The weight of 3 bags of rice is 3kg 200g, 5 kg 675g and 6 kg 115g. The total weight of rice is 14 kg 890g.

    A) Only (i) is true.

    B) Only (ii) is true

    C) Neither (i), nor (it) is true.

    D) Both (i) and (ii) are true.

    Correct Answer: A

    Solution :

    A: Money left with saurabh \[\begin{align}   & =\text{Rs}\,50.00 \\  & \,\,\,\,\,\underline{\text{Rs}45.25} \\  & \,\,\,\,\,\underline{\text{Rs}4.75\,\,}\,\,\, \\ \end{align}\] B: Total weight of rice is = 3kg 200g 5kg 675g 6kg 115g 14kg 990g
